Mary Alice (Ring) Ellis

Mary Alice (Ring) Ellis was born in Sardinia on June 23, 1937 to Lorin William and Alice Edith (Baker) Ring. 

She finished her sojourn on earth Oct. 21, 2025.  

Mary Alice graduated from Sardinia High School in 1955, recently celebrating her 70th alumni, and worked for a year at the VA hospital in Cincinnati. Despite that, her dream was to be a wife and mother, and she excelled at it. Known for her creativity and ingenuity, she orchestrated church programs, vacation Bible schools, PTO fundraisers and sewed clothing and costumes. The family has wonderful memories of weeklong vacations for six people in a pop-up camper. As the children grew up, she worked part-time with her husband, Jimmy, at Ellis Feed Mill as a secretary and bookkeeper.
